Q: How are aluminum coils used in the production of electrical conductors?
Due to their excellent electrical conductivity and lightweight properties, aluminum coils find wide application in the production of electrical conductors. Typically manufactured from high-grade aluminum alloy, these coils ensure optimal electrical performance. To achieve the desired shape and dimensions of the electrical conductor, the production process involves initially forming the aluminum coils into thin, flat strips. These strips then undergo further processing using techniques like rolling, annealing, and drawing. After processing and forming, a thin layer of insulating material, such as enamel or varnish, is applied to the aluminum coil. This coating serves to prevent electrical leakage, ensure proper insulation, and protect against corrosion and environmental factors. The high conductivity and efficient electrical current-carrying capacity of aluminum coils make them commonly used in the production of electrical conductors like wires and cables. They are particularly favored in industries where weight is a crucial consideration, such as aerospace and automotive. Moreover, aluminum coils offer cost advantages over alternative materials, making them a popular choice for electrical conductor production. Their lightweight nature also facilitates easier installation and handling, reducing labor costs and time. In conclusion, aluminum coils are essential in the production of electrical conductors, providing excellent electrical conductivity, lightweight properties, and cost advantages. Their versatility and efficiency make them the preferred choice in various industries where electrical conductivity is of utmost importance.
Q: What is the maximum temperature resistance of aluminum coils?
Various factors, including alloy composition, purity, and specific application, determine the maximum temperature resistance of aluminum coils. Generally, aluminum has a low melting point of approximately 660 degrees Celsius (1220 degrees Fahrenheit). As a result, the temperature resistance of aluminum coils typically falls between 200 and 400 degrees Celsius (392 to 752 degrees Fahrenheit). Exceeding these temperatures may lead to structural alterations in aluminum, such as softening or deformation, which could affect its performance and integrity. Consequently, it is crucial to consider the specific demands and limitations of the application when determining the maximum temperature resistance of aluminum coils.

Q: Can aluminum coils be used in food processing or packaging?
Yes, aluminum coils can be used in food processing or packaging. Aluminum is widely used in the food industry due to its excellent properties such as being lightweight, non-toxic, and resistant to corrosion. These properties make it an ideal material for food processing and packaging applications. Aluminum coils can be used to make various food packaging products such as cans, lids, foils, and trays. They provide a barrier against oxygen, moisture, and light, which helps to preserve the freshness and quality of food products. Additionally, aluminum coils are easy to shape, form, and seal, allowing for efficient and effective packaging solutions. Overall, aluminum coils are a popular choice for food processing and packaging due to their versatility, durability, and safety.
Q: How do aluminum coils compare to steel coils in terms of strength?
Aluminum coils and steel coils differ significantly in terms of strength. Steel coils are generally stronger and more durable than aluminum coils. Steel is known for its high tensile strength and ability to withstand heavy loads, making it a preferred choice for applications that require high strength and durability. On the other hand, aluminum coils have a lower strength compared to steel. Aluminum is a lightweight metal with a lower tensile strength, which means it may not be as resistant to heavy loads or stress as steel coils. However, aluminum coils have other favorable properties such as excellent corrosion resistance and high thermal conductivity. The choice between aluminum and steel coils depends on the specific application and requirements. If strength and durability are the primary concerns, steel coils are usually the better option. However, if weight reduction, corrosion resistance, or thermal conductivity are more important, aluminum coils might be the preferred choice.
